changeset 81a91c60756a in tryton-overlay:default details: https://hg.tryton.org/tryton-overlay?cmd=changeset;node=81a91c60756a description: dev-python/tablib: New ebuild
(Portage version: 2.3.89/hg/Linux x86_64, signed Manifest commit with key 0x574F6EFF4E477517) Signed-off-by: Cédric Krier <c...@gentoo.org> diffstat: dev-python/tablib/Manifest | 20 +++++++++++++++++ dev-python/tablib/metadata.xml | 8 +++++++ dev-python/tablib/tablib-1.1.0.ebuild | 39 +++++++++++++++++++++++++++++++++++ 3 files changed, 67 insertions(+), 0 deletions(-) diffs (79 lines): diff -r 13cd61ee4def -r 81a91c60756a dev-python/tablib/Manifest --- /dev/null Thu Jan 01 00:00:00 1970 +0000 +++ b/dev-python/tablib/Manifest Fri May 08 17:42:07 2020 +0200 @@ -0,0 +1,20 @@ +-----BEGIN PGP SIGNED MESSAGE----- +Hash: SHA256 + +DIST tablib-1.1.0.tar.gz 74953 BLAKE2B 69a5d66992c557612ffe027a693c11f6a265a9ab62a6220ee036667df44aff6535ad89cbf647ee78d113a25366b9bd0bd50a45cfa132abb8f9e70119b2059813 SHA512 d6a1a2aecf96353897043fa08daf122e042ea48d313113d2946ff253315751e58a26eaced53e52fae1ff322563ff319ab5868e6e1891e76f26018b6251d76cb9 +EBUILD tablib-1.1.0.ebuild 863 BLAKE2B ccd0f2624c3580904c8488a2140dd624daa01ac1d0013e231e218fce5fbf2ce4c114081ac430c000cd7e529f034332611af093548c2f589d112ae254508643d0 SHA512 a840c04979906e3dab4b5d35e5d808c4d7917ec2f60811fcff0e4591c2161126533407695998066fa0d880faed68df5c3e1bfca6911df73a639f13aae078776f +MISC metadata.xml 241 BLAKE2B 8d27e5418bef2dffe2becb2e4dee0ae1cf02da46ae6c8f9d7f0f4191b9b1d6e1f0b3f97b989633875ddcc9ab0be83b3d76da02d73d6189d22c56dd9872e0ddaf SHA512 822d51a7a83ac88dc470a783fd47c26009fe930492b69eb540739c23f724654eab8252950d276ee07a040465bd41ec4fd206d9ec340cf92b232cc2a99b965886 +-----BEGIN PGP SIGNATURE----- +Version: GnuPG v2 + +iQGTBAEBCAB9FiEEdP/VdIYNMe45RAljV09u/05HdRcFAl61fc9fFIAAAAAALgAo +aXNzdWVyLWZwckBub3RhdGlvbnMub3BlbnBncC5maWZ0aGhvcnNlbWFuLm5ldDc0 +RkZENTc0ODYwRDMxRUUzOTQ0MDk2MzU3NEY2RUZGNEU0Nzc1MTcACgkQV09u/05H +dRfy9Af9HtiGPHl8v91/rEqQhDUbigyux1DDI10yF7AQ3qUjg3JY2dNLC2dODbr6 +epmvnXq+YYwtv2oOoT5Rr3VeabcVxaMZbmdWTiwY9r1AO7dokVtM6FBu4wxDH7tQ +c01FCu7Sv6nz1LmlJv/ya5MqDjQ5YTIKGOuNnSJTJtLKU+f6icE9sVd+HrOOCTAW +B1jpp9mYq9M13VtYizYD7Q1EMWP5NCBaw5GyYUVOKazvyjWNoodP3D4hvVwG4zro +V9FKt1AAtWxtqsFJbTbYLaQVg09F1cuEbwgYN6IGVccJ6UL6FwM1hcf2P2zWdbg4 +TneNkwD6efUVJUkbFtXwd++Eb2QVeQ== +=dGFp +-----END PGP SIGNATURE----- diff -r 13cd61ee4def -r 81a91c60756a dev-python/tablib/metadata.xml --- /dev/null Thu Jan 01 00:00:00 1970 +0000 +++ b/dev-python/tablib/metadata.xml Fri May 08 17:42:07 2020 +0200 @@ -0,0 +1,8 @@ +<?xml version="1.0" encoding="UTF-8"?> +<!DOCTYPE pkgmetadata SYSTEM "http://www.gentoo.org/dtd/metadata.dtd"> +<pkgmetadata> + <maintainer type="person"> + <email>c...@b2ck.com</email> + <name>Cédric Krier</name> + </maintainer> +</pkgmetadata> diff -r 13cd61ee4def -r 81a91c60756a dev-python/tablib/tablib-1.1.0.ebuild --- /dev/null Thu Jan 01 00:00:00 1970 +0000 +++ b/dev-python/tablib/tablib-1.1.0.ebuild Fri May 08 17:42:07 2020 +0200 @@ -0,0 +1,39 @@ +# Copyright 1999-2020 Gentoo Authors +# Distributed under the terms of the GNU General Public License v2 + +EAPI=7 +PYTHON_COMPAT=( python3_{5..7} ) + +inherit distutils-r1 + +DESCRIPTION="A format-agnostic tabular dataset library written in Python" +HOMEPAGE="https://tablib.readthedocs.io/" +SRC_URI="mirror://pypi/${PN:0:1}/${PN}/${P}.tar.gz" + +SLOT="0" +LICENSE="MIT" +KEYWORDS="~amd64 ~x86" +IUSE="test" + +RDEPEND=" + dev-python/markuppy[${PYTHON_USEDEP}] + dev-python/odfpy[${PYTHON_USEDEP}] + >=dev-python/openpyxl-2.6.0[${PYTHON_USEDEP}] + dev-python/pandas[${PYTHON_USEDEP}] + dev-python/pyyaml[${PYTHON_USEDEP}] + dev-python/tabulate[${PYTHON_USEDEP}] + dev-python/xlrd[${PYTHON_USEDEP}] + dev-python/xlwt[${PYTHON_USEDEP}] +" + +DEPEND=" + dev-python/setuptools[${PYTHON_USEDEP}] + test? ( + ${RDEPEND} + dev-python/pytest[${PYTHON_USEDEP}] + ) +" + +python_test() { + pytest || die +}